Sprint Canberra Race 5, ANU. I can't really see the map well enough while running and its a bit of a problem. Sucked into the trap at 6 (a dead end) - no excuse, should have seen it on the map.

A great series overall. Orienteering is a great sport in that you can be competitive even when you can't train - I was 2-2 versus Blair and he has done 1,229km running(+O) in the last 5 months to my 78km. Thats 56km per week vs. 4km.

Remembrance Park, Canberra. A bush sprint with loops, not usually my favourite type, but this was a good one. A bit rocky underfoot, managed to spike all of the controls and get to the third common control with Patrik, my Hagaby runner (off same time). He pulled out another 35 seconds on the last two loops though - I wasn't able to run that fast with steel studs on the bitumen around the War Memorial. Also took a bit of time to spot the line to 15.

Sprint Canberra at Radford College. Okm 2.2. Spent most of this race very confused and running slow. There were two maps and 4 loops, plus twice back through the assembly area. A fitting end to the confusion was getting to 25 and not picking that was the last control. Didn't see the line connecting 25 to the finish until after I finished - it was very close to the line from 24. Thought it might have been on the other map on the back so turned it over a few times. Eventually worked it out by reading the descriptions.

I really liked this course though, mainly because it was all in the buildings; the setter resisted the temptation to go for the ovals or the termite mound in the bush up the hill.

Pretty careful on the wet stairs and slopes. Also kept checking the map to see what in front of me was passable - lots was but didn't really look it.
